1. Культура и развлечения
  2. Книги
  3. Информатика, интернет
  4. Программирование

Architektura aplikacji w Pythonie Percival Gregory



#товара: 17271153905

Все товары продавца: tantis_pl

Состояние Новый

Счет-фактура Я выставляю счет-фактуру НДС

Язык издания польский

Название Architektura aplikacji w Pythonie. TDD, DDD i rozwój mikrousług reaktywnych

Издательство Гелион

Обложка мягкая

Материал бумажная книга

Количество страниц Двести пятьдесят шесть

Год выпуска Две тысячи двадцать

Серия O'Reilly

Вес с индивидуальной упаковкой 0.422 кг

Высота изделия 24 см

Ширина 17 см

Тематика Python

Номер вопроса Один

Боб Грегори

Harry Percival

Количество 1 штук

  • Количество

  • Проблемы? Сомнения? Вопросы? Задайте вопрос!

    Architektura aplikacji w Pythonie

    Autor: Harry Percival, Bob Gregory

    EAN: 9788328371262

    Typ publikacji: książka

    Strony: 256

    Oprawa: Miękka

    Wydawca: Helion

    SID: 2918783

    Architektura aplikacji w Pythonie

    Architektura aplikacji w Pythonie. TDD, DDD i rozwój mikrousług reaktywnychPython zyskuje coraz większą popularność i jest wykorzystywany do tworzenia bardzo różnych aplikacji, jednak projektowanie dużych, niezawodnych systemów w tym języku bywa wyzwaniem. Rozwijanie złożonych systemów o wysokiej jakości wymaga zastosowania odpowiedniej architektury. Trudno w Pythonie stosować takie wysokopoziomowe wzorce projektowe jak architektura sześciokątna, architektura oparta na zdarzeniach czy wzorce zalecane dla projektowania dziedzinowego (DDD). Sytuacji nie poprawia również to, że klasyczna literatura dotycząca metod zarządzania złożonością aplikacji zawiera przykłady kodu napisanego w Javie lub C#. Programiści Pythona często więc uznają takie książki za mało przydatne w swojej praktyczny przewodnik przybliży projektantom pracującym w Pythonie sprawdzone wzorce architektury, które ułatwiają zapanowanie nad złożonością aplikacji i pozwalają najlepiej wykorzystać zestawy testów. Prezentację poszczególnych wzorców architektury oparto na przykładowej, stopniowo rozbudowywanej aplikacji. Podejście to pozwoliło na pokazanie zalet metodyki TDD. Z kolei w rozdziałach poświęconych modelowaniu dziedzinowemu zwrócono uwagę na unikanie jakichkolwiek zależności zewnętrznych przy równoczesnym zapewnieniu integralności danych. Wśród ciekawszych koncepcji warto wskazać wykorzystywanie zdarzeń w roli wzorca integracji usług w architekturze mikrousługowej. Niejako przy okazji zaprezentowano praktyczne strony stosowania kilku frameworków i technologii Pythona, między innymi Flask, SQLAlchemy, pytest, Docker i Redis.W tej książce między innymi:modelowanie dziedzinowe i stosowanie wzorców DDDjednostki, obiekty wartości i agregaty w architekturze domenowejtworzenie modeli bez zbędnych zależnościzdarzenia, polecenia i szyna wiadomościwzorce architektury zdarzeniowej i mikrousług reaktywnychArchitektura nowoczesnych aplikacji w Pythonie: rozwiązania dla poważnych systemów!

    Корзина 0